I'm using a lonewolf ultimate adjustable, much improved trigger face/shoe and more comfortable. It uses a polished OEM trigger bar and you don't need to adjust for travel unless you want to. Nice effective and value for money.
 
I run Zev ultimate fulcrum. with lighter striker spring and lighter striker safety pin spring. I think it comes with a dot connector. I have all internal sliding parts mirror polished which makes a difference.

Dont go too light on the connector since it doesnt directly make the trigger lighter but changes the "gearing" so it will get lighter but will need more travel. Some trigger weight can be reduced through slightly lighter striker and pin springs and polishing the internals (dont do too light tho or it will misfire unless you get a light striker and then might still misfire)

In my opinion the biggest issue with glock triggers is the overtravel and the lack of a trigger stop. there are trigger housings with trigger stop but have never seen one available here (I will DIY one). The zev trigger helps a lot with over travel and is adjustable but in my opinion does not really adjust over travel as it only adjusts on the trigger shoe. which by the way feels better and is almost worth it. Also trigger reset is much better.

The best triggers are IMO from Johnny Glock (look up on youtube) but not available here unless you go through self import
 
Remember with touching striker springs, any other weight than stick will have trouble lighting cci and other primers, you need federal primers for it to function.
